
La Californie, Cannes 1956. (see also Pic570147)
At the Villa La Californie in Cannes, 1956, a stylized, elongated head sculpture with a feathered headdress and dark braids rests on a cluttered wooden desk. It is surrounded by an assortment of items, including scattered papers, a smaller sculpted figure, a glass bottle, and writing utensils. Behind the sculpture, two large sketches are propped up: one showing a bold zigzag line, the other a complex cubist-style drawing of an animal head.
